Korschenbroich climate — normals and trends
Korschenbroich (Germany) has a temperate oceanic climate (Cfb) under the Köppen-Geiger classification. Its mean annual temperature is 10.2 °C and it receives 809 mm of precipitation per year.
These figures are normals computed over 86 complete calendar years, from 1940 to 2025, using ERA5 reanalysis data from the Copernicus programme.
The warmest month is July (18.3 °C on average) and the coldest is January (2.3 °C). Rainfall peaks in July.
Korschenbroich averages 48 frost days, 4 hot days (≥ 30 °C) and 152 rainy days per year.
Korschenbroich has warmed by +2.1 °C between 1940 and 2025, or +0.25 °C per decade. This trend is statistically significant.
The number of frost days there went from about 63 to 33 per year over the period.
The hottest day of the period reached 39.9 °C (on 25 July 2019) and the coldest -23.6 °C (on 27 January 1942).
Data from ERA5 reanalysis (Copernicus Climate Change Service), redistributed under a CC-BY 4.0 licence. Normals are recomputed whenever the archive is updated.
